Health Services Administrator (HSA)
The Health Services Administrator manages and evaluates the health care delivery program to ensure compliance with regulations and accreditation standards. They oversee implementation of policies, monitor subcontracted services, ensure quality and cost‑effective medical, dental, and mental health care, and direct recruitment, orientation, performance evaluations, and continuing education for staff. They also review and manage inmate health cases, hospitalizations, and referrals to optimize care and control costs. Maintaining communication with facility leadership, staff, external partners, and promoting quality improvement initiatives is part of the role.
